Chicago Bears’ running back David Montgomery is expect to miss 2-4 weeks with a groin injury he sustained in practice on Wednesday.
#Bears starting RB David Montgomery, who went down in practice yesterday with a groin injury, is expected to be out 2-4 weeks, source said. That gives him a chance of being out on the field for the opener vs. the #Lions.

Fantasy Impact
Montgomery was all set to start for the Bears Week 1 but it seems like that won’t happen now. After a disappointing season, there was hope that Montgomery might start this year off stronger now being a year into Matt Nagy’s offense. With no Montgomery, I would expect to see a larger workload for Tarik Cohen on rushing downs (he already is a big contributor in the passing game).
